The Scenario
You're a digital marketer and your reporting tool filters campaign data by Short.io tags. Your director just told you this morning that all links from the spring promotion need to be tagged "spring-campaign" before the Q2 wrap-up report runs Friday evening. You have 300 link IDs in column A of an Excel table. It is Tuesday.
The bad version:
- Open Short.io, search for the first link ID, navigate to the edit screen, add the tag "spring-campaign", save
- Repeat 300 times, switching between the Short.io dashboard and your Excel workbook to track your progress
- Hit Short.io's rate limit after 200 links, wait, lose track of which row you were on when the limit hit, and spend 20 minutes auditing your progress before resuming
The reporting tool runs Friday evening. If those links aren't tagged, the Q2 campaign metrics will be incomplete and your director will open the report Saturday morning to missing data she'll immediately flag.
The Easy Way: One Prompt in SheetXAI
SheetXAI is an AI agent that lives inside your Excel workbook. It reads your link IDs, calls Short.io's bulk tag endpoint for the full list, and writes the confirmation back into column B.
Apply the tag 'spring-campaign' to all 300 link IDs in column A of my Excel table in one bulk Short.io operation
What You Get
- Short.io applies the tag "spring-campaign" to all 300 links in a single bulk operation
- Column B shows the result status for each row — success or error reason
- The bulk endpoint means you stay within rate limits without splitting the work into multiple sessions
What If the Data Is Not Quite Ready
Some IDs in column A are already tagged from a partial manual attempt
You started tagging links manually last week before realizing the scale of the task.
Check each link ID in column A with Short.io before tagging — only apply the tag "spring-campaign" to links that don't already have it, and write the final tag status into column B for all rows
The column includes blank rows and placeholder text from an incomplete import
Whoever assembled the table left some rows with "pending" or empty cells in column A.
Skip any row in column A where the link ID is blank, "pending", or not a numeric value — then apply the tag "spring-campaign" to all valid Short.io link IDs in one bulk operation and write the result status into column B
Your director added a second tag requirement this morning: also apply "Q2-2026"
The reporting tool filters by both tags independently.
Apply both the tags "spring-campaign" and "Q2-2026" to every Short.io link ID in column A using the bulk tag endpoint and write the operation status into column B
Full validation plus dual tagging in one shot
Filter column A to only include rows with numeric link IDs, remove duplicates, then apply tags "spring-campaign" and "Q2-2026" to all valid IDs in one bulk Short.io operation — write the outcome status for each row into column B
The reporting tool gets clean, complete data before Friday evening.
Try It
Get the 7-day free trial of SheetXAI and open any Excel workbook where you need to retroactively label a batch of Short.io links — then tell it which tag to apply and let it handle the rest. Also see how to bulk-archive links you're done with, or enrich your link inventory to verify which ones are still active before tagging.
